Some quick ways of earning a few Bloodpoints are to break the pallets that have been thrown down and damage generators in the process of being fixed. As the killer, if someone throws a pallet down, you can pause to kick it and break it. You can also pause by generators that are not completely fixed and damage them, making it take a little longer to repair them. The killers each have unique abilities and the survivors have perks and tools that can be utilized and may be extremely handy for gaining some Bloodpoints. For example, survivors can carry a torch that can be used to blind the killer (and force him to drop a survivor he’s holding!). One of the other extremely handy perks is to alert you when the killer is coming. You can hear their heartbeat when they get extremely close, but some of the perks give you a wider radius, or just inform you when the killer is in your line of vision even if you can’t see them yet. You can create a private match in both games to just play with your friends but Friday is just better set up for it. You can create a private match entirely or you can buddy up in a party system and be loaded into a lobby with other random people to be set up for a full match.
